Lasers and other sources

Equipment Specifications
Mai Tai ultrafast Ti:Sapphire laser + Inspire OPO fs laser
  • Wavelength: signal: 490-750 nm, Idler: 930-2500 nm, Fundamental: 690-1040 nm
  • Max Power: signal: 350 mW, Idler: 170 mW, Fundamental: 1000 mW
  • Repetition Frequency: 80 MHz
  • Pulse duration: 200 fs
Fianium supercontinuum SC450 laser (2x)
  • Wavelength: 490 nm - 1800 nm / 400 nm - 1750 nm (400 nm - 700 nm with AOTF)
  • Max Power: 500 mW / 6 W
  • Repetition Frequency: 80 MHz / 20 MHz
Thorlabs Fabry-Perot Quantum Cascade Laser
  • Wavelength: 4550 nm
  • Max Power: 200 mW
Cobolt Rumba 1064 nm CW laser
  • Wavelength: 1064 nm
  • Max Power: 3.6 W
He – Ne CW laser
  • Wavelength: 632.8 nm
  • Max Power: 5 mW
Thorlabs LDM405 Fabry-Perot CW laser diode
  • Wavelength: 405 nm
  • Max Power: 4 mW
KIMMON KONA
  • Wavelength: 325 nm
  • Max Power: 50 mW
IMPATT Diodes
  • Frequency: 142.2 and 292 GHz
  • Max Power: 42.8 and 9.4 mW

Spectrometers and microscopes

Equipment Specifications

Renishaw inVia Reflex Spectrometer System for confocal Raman spectral imaging

  • Visible excitation at 457nm, 532 nm, 633 nm and 785 nm
  • Research Grade Leica microscope allowing confocal measurements

Vertex 70/70v FTIR spectrometer with HYPERION 1000 Microscope

  • Wavelength range: 300 nm - 30 µm
  • Magnification: 4x, 15x
Andor SR-500 spectrometer with EMCDD/PMT
  • Wavelength range: 200 nm – 2000 nm
TERA K15 All fiber-coupled time-domain terahertz spectrometer
  • Frequency: 0.2 – 3 THz
  • Dynamic range: >60 dB
  • Maximum scan range: 350 ps
  • Spectral resolution: >3 GHz
  • THz imaging extension (planar scan) + ImageLab software
  • Temperature-controlled (from ambient to circa 250°C) experiments of liquids and solids with SPECAC cells
Toptica TeraFlash Pro Dual (2 emitters + 2 detectors)
  • Frequency: 0.2 – 6.5 THz
  • Peak dynamic range: >105 dB
  • Maximum scan range: 2000 ps
  • Spectral resolution: >0.5 GHz
  • THz imaging extension (planar scan)
  • Reflection head
  • Purge box
  • Near-field capability with Protemics TeraSpike TD-1550-X-HR-WT and TD-1550-X-HR-WT-XR
  • Temperature-controlled (from ambient to circa 250°C) experiments of liquids and solids with SPECAC cells
Toptica TeraScan 1550 with tuning range extension
  • Frequency: DC – 3 THz
  • Peak dynamic range: >100 dB
  • Spectral resolution: >10 MHz
  • Tuning speed: Up to 100 GHz/s
  • Frequency accuracy: <2 GHz
  • Reflection head
JEOL aberration-corrected scanning transmission electron microscopy (AC-STEM)
  • Electron source: Schottky emitter
  • 200/80 kV
  • Resolution: 0.08 nm
  • Specimen max size: standard TEM grid, 3.05 mm diameter, ~20 µm thickness
Scienta Omicron Low Temperature Scanning Tunneling Microscope
  • Ultra High Vacuum
Scienta Omicron Variable Temperature Scanning Tunneling Microscope
  • Ultra High Vacuum

Vector network analysers

Equipment Specifications
Keysight PNA-L N5234B
  • Maximum frequency: 43.5 GHz
  • Dynamic range: 122 dB
  • Spectral resolution: 1 Hz
  • Used along with a XYZ-translation stage for near-field measurements
Keysight PNA-L N5232A
  • Maximum frequency: 20 GHz
  • Dynamic range: 133 dB
  • Spectral resolution: 1 Hz
HP 3585A Spectrum Analyzer
  • Frequency range: 20 Hz – 40.1 MHz
  • Dynamic range: 80 dB
  • Spectral resolution: 0.1 Hz

Miscellaneous

Equipment Specifications

attoDRY800 closed-cycle cryostat integrated into optical table

  • Sample environment: cryogenic vacuum

  • Sample space (diameter): 75 mm

  • Ultra-low vibrations at cold plate: <5 nm (peak-to-peak@1500 Hz)

  • Temperature range: 3.8 - 320 K

  • Temperature stability: < 15 mK (peak-to-peak with thermally damped sample holder)

  • Cooldown time: < 4.5 h to 5 K

  • Base pressure in sample chamber: <5e-6 mbar

  • 36 electrical contacts into sample area included (heat sunk @ 4 K)

Micromeritics TriStar II PLUS surface area analyser

  • Pressure measurement range: 0 to 950 mmHg with 0.05 mmHg resolution

  • Specific surface area analysis: from 0.01 m2/g

  • Total surface area analysis: from 0.1 m2

  • Pore volume analysis: from 4x10-6 cm3/g

TeraSense Tera-1024

  • Sensitivity optimized at 140 GHz

  • Pixel size: 1.5 mm x 1.5 mm

  • Noise Equivalent Power: 1 nW/√Hz

Ophir Pyrocam IV

  • Broadband sensitivity

  • Pixel size: 75μm x 75μm

  • Noise Equivalent Power: 13nW/√Hz/pixel (1Hz)

Spatial light modulator

  • Holoeye PLUTO Phase Only Spatial Light Modulator

  • Wavelength range: 420 nm - 700 nm

  • Resolution: 1920*1080

  • Pixel Patch: 8 µm

PSV-400 Scanning Vibrometer

  • Working distance: > 0.4 m to about 100 m

  • Sample size: Several mm2 up to m2 range

Fabrication

Equipment Specifications

Nanoscribe’s Photonic Professional GT+

  • 3D lateral feature size (IP-Dip): ≤ 200 nm; typically 150 nm

  • 2D lateral resolution (IP-Dip): ≤ 500 nm; typically 300 nm

  • Vertical resolution (IP-Dip): ≤ 1000 nm; typically 800 nm

  • Piezo range: 300×300×300 μm³

  • Writing speed piezo mode typ. 100 µm/s

  • Accessible writing area: up to 100×100 mm²

DEKEMA 674S sinter oven

  • Vacuum operation

  • Firing chamber 100 mm x 50 mm (diameter x height)

BOC EDWARD Physical Vapour Evaporation System

  • Chamber dimensions 50 cm x 50 cm x 70 cm

  • Sputter up

  • Source types: Au

  • Deposition are: 5 mm x 10 mm

EMS150R S Rotary Pumped Sputter Coating System

  • Work chamber: Borosilicate glass 152mm Ø (inside) × 127mm height

Software and Computing

Members have access to a range of commercial CAD/CEM and in-house software, including:

  • Comsol Multiphysics
  • CST Studio
  • Ansys Optics (formely known as Lumerical)

In addition to access to BlueBEAR, the University supercomputer for high performance computing and high throughput computing, the Group has several local servers for solving complex electromagnetic problems with the above commercial software and to support the development of the in-house computational electromagnetics software.
